      Let's go for this bet on this Indonesian Super League match between Borneo FC and Dewa United FC. The home team has a strong attacking game and a good offensive style. They also have good midfield penetration, are quite dangerous, and play a very combative game. They apply a lot of pressure in their marking and have been solid at home. On the other hand, the visitors have been showing average play in both midfield and defense. This team also plays with little pressure in their marking. So, I think it's possible that the home team can win this match, so I'm going with this bet on the home team. Good luck to everyone, let's go for it!       ENGLISH: The home team in this match is BORNEO FC, who currently sits in first place in the standings with 17 goals scored and 4 conceded in 9 matches. Last season, they were in fifth place, scoring 50 goals and conceding 38 in 34 matches. The away team in this match is DEWA UNITED, who currently sits in 13th place in the standings with 11 goals scored and 16 conceded in 9 matches. Last season, they were in second place with 65 goals scored and 33 conceded in 34 matches. In their last three matches: Home Team: won 3 and drew 0, scoring 8 goals and conceding 2. Away Team: won 0 and drew 1, scoring 1 goal and conceding 5. In their last three matches, the home team has won 3 and scored 6 goals and conceded 1. In the last three away matches, the Away Team has won once and drawn zero, scoring two goals and conceding three.
